### **Recommendation:**1. **Verify the Problem** Before purchasing, confirm that the power supply is indeed the faulty component. Test other parts (e.g., fuse, connections) to avoid unnecessary spending.
2. **Compare Prices** Check Sony s official website, authorized distributors, and reputable electronics marketplaces (e.g., Amazon, eBay) for the best deal. Ensure the seller is verified to avoid counterfeit parts.
3. **Consider Professional Installation** If you re not experienced with electronics, have a technician install the board to avoid voiding warranties or causing further damage.
